Rhode Island Code § 23-3-25.2

Incarcerated persons’ exemption for fees for copies and searches

Any incarcerated person who is set to be released from prison to re-enter the community shall be processed without a charge or fee when making a first request for vital statistics at the department of health regarding a request for their own personal records.
